Tips for Using a Decorative Display Font
While Dahlia is visually striking, using a decorative font effectively requires some consideration. Here’s how to integrate it seamlessly into your work:
Prioritize Readability: Due to its ornate details, Dahlia is best suited for large sizes, such as titles, headlines, or logos. Avoid using it for long paragraphs of body text, where a cleaner serif or sans serif font would maintain legibility.
Test Font Pairings: Balance its complexity with simpler typefaces. Pairing Dahlia with a classic serif font or a clean sans serif font for supporting text creates a harmonious hierarchy, ensuring your message is both beautiful and clear.
Match the Mood: Ensure the font's character aligns with your project's tone. Its floral, handcrafted quality is perfect for themes of nature, romance, luxury, or creativity. For more formal or corporate contexts, it might be used sparingly as an accent.
Review Licensing: Before downloading, always check the font license to confirm it covers your intended use, whether for personal projects or commercial client work.
